“…Dielectric barrier discharge (DBD) plasma with a mixture of N 2 and O 2 as a carrier gas was used for decontamination of AFs on hazelnuts, achieving 70% of decontamination of AFB 1 after a 12‐min treatment with plasma operated at 1000 W. [ 16 ] An 88% removal of AFB 1 on corn was observed after being exposed to indirect ambient air CAP treatment for 30 min, which was created with a high‐voltage DBD system. [ 17 ] Wielogorska et al [ 18 ] exposed the AFB 1 ‐ and fumonisin B 1 (FB 1 )‐contaminated corn kernels to plasma jet at a voltage of 6 kV and a continuous frequency of 20 kHz using a mixture of helium and O 2 as an operating gas. Up to 66% decontamination was achieved after 10 min of treatment for both AFB 1 and FB 1 .…”

“…Energy dissipated in the discharge gap was assumed to have induced chemical reactions with reactive species such as O, O 3 , OH and NO x and/or decomposition of the toxins after collision with ions and electrons, leading to cleavage of molecular bonds (Ten Bosch et al, 2017). Likewise, a 100% AFB 1 and FB 1 reduction in pure mycotoxin standards and 65% AFB 1 as well as 64% FB 1 reduction were recorded in maize (Wielogorska et al ., 2019), with degradation products reported. Observations from this study confirmed the formation of up to six new novel compounds during plasma treatment.…”
